Simona Florea’s art is at heart based on the purist notion of geometric, clean two-dimensional shapes, uniting the positive qualities of precision and simplicity by stripping the unnecessary and retaining the essential.
For her, each work is created through a synthesis of the Hegelian dialectic, from the very conception of the idea through every layer until its finish. An evolution by opposing sides unified in contradiction only to transmute into the next layer and start over again until the work has reached its completion.
However, as opposed to purist aesthetics, Simona places the human, specifically the female figure at the center as inspirational but also integral to her work. Recently, mirroring her personal inner work, she introduces a new opposing side to the discourse, challenging its current limitations to reach closer to universal beauty and harmony- calling it “stepping out of the self-imposed lines” allowing space to break the rules and to become.
